£15k, local church and family friends field with marquee DIY festival with toilet hire, band & DJ was my mates and siblings, we self ran the bar bringing in some local kids drafted from my pub to be servers. Catering provided by a local chef, mother in law made desserts and wedding cake.
Should add, we bought and then sold on a lot of the additional things you don’t usually think of - lanterns, flower caddies, fire pits, which actually helped us clawback some spending.

Everything has a scale or a compromise…
Free bar vs guests pay
Canapés or none
Live band vs dj
Live ceremony music vs speakers
All day guest/evening guest ratio
A dress can be anything from £500 to £10000+
Spend money on the things that matter to you, everything else can be a compromise which you likely won’t remember.
